    Sometimes it's hard to differentiate one cobb salad from another, but this one is a clear winner. Straining the egg whites and yolks seperately gave a pleasingly smooth texture that matched well with the avacado, lobster and tomato, and contrasted nicely with the green beans, bacon and cheese in both texture and taste. The dressing was great and did not overpower the sweetness of the lobster.
